Lot 149 | HUA YAN (1682-1756)
Estimate value
HKD 100 000 – 180 000
Recluse and his Attendant
Hanging scroll, ink and colour on paper
123.8 x 46.5 cm. (48 ¾ x 18 ¼ in.)
Inscribed and signed, with three seals of the artist
Dated first month, jiachen year of the Yongzheng period (1724)
Four collector’s seals, including one of Jing Jianquan (Qing Dynasty) and one of Ma Jizuo (1915-2009)
Literature
From Protégé to Master - The Chinese Painting Collection of Harold Wong, Christie’s Hong Kong, May 2024, pp.70-71.
Exhibited
Hong Kong, Hong Kong Convention and Exhibition Centre, From Protégé to Master – The Chinese Painting Collection of Harold Wong, 25 – 30 May 2024.
